| I need help with sooty mold!
I know I need to control my p/s insects and keeps ants away, but is there anything I can do once I have the sooty mold?
I've tried strong streams of water and soapy water, but I have to manually rub the leaves to get the mold off, and there are too many leaves to do that. And even the rubbing doesn't seem to remove it all.
